[LeetCode] 451. Sort Characters By Frequency @ python
一.题目:给一个字符串,将它按照字母的个数降序排列.二.解题思路:首先统计字符串中每个字母的个数,然后将键和值放入到堆中,这里注意细节是将值放在前面,这样堆中会默认根据值的大小来建立堆.其实还有一种简单的方法,即利用collections.Counter(s).most_common()这一方法直接得到按个数排列的列表.代码如下:class Solution(object): ...